Your Guide to Navigating Target Field’s Seating Options

Home to the Minnesota Twins, Target Field is a premier MLB stadium known for its intimate design and stunning downtown Minneapolis views. With a capacity of 38,544, it offers diverse seating options tailored to different budgets and preferences. Whether you're catching a baseball game or a concert, understanding the seating chart ensures the best experience.

Target Field Seating Chart Breakdown

  • Lower Level (Sections 1-33): Closest to the action, with Sections 1-10 behind home plate offering premium views. Avoid far corners (Sections 30-33) for potential obstructions.
  • Club Level (Sections 201-232): Mid-tier pricing with cushioned seats, climate-controlled lounges, and shorter concession lines. Ideal for balance between comfort and view.
  • Upper Level (Sections 301-338): Budget-friendly with panoramic views. Rows 1-3 in Sections 314-324 provide excellent elevation for tracking gameplay.

Best Seats for Different Events

  • Baseball: Sections 114-118 (1st/3rd base) for dugout proximity. Avoid Sections 239-241 (right field) for sun glare.
  • Concerts: Sections C/D near the stage or 200-level for unobstructed sightlines.

VIP & Accessibility

  • Delta Sky360° Club: All-inclusive food/beverages and premium field views.
  • Suites: Private lounges with catering; ideal for groups.
  • Accessibility: Wheelchair-accessible seating in every section; companion seats available.

Pro Tips

  • Use 3D seat maps to preview sightlines.
  • For shade, choose 3rd base side (Sections 120-128).
  • Check resale platforms for discounted club-level seats.
